The journey from Conwy to Denbigh covers approximately 30 kilometers through the heart of the Vale of Clwyd. Driving is the most practical method, typically taking 40 minutes via the A547 and B5381. Public transport is limited to bus services, which may require a change in Abergele or St Asaph. Denbigh is a historic market town famous for its castle and medieval town walls. This route offers a glimpse into the rural beauty of North Wales, passing through charming villages and farmland. It is a popular route for those exploring the inland heritage sites of the region.
Total Distance: 30 km driving distance, 25 km straight-line air distance.
